UPVC Window Repairs

Upvc windows require minimal maintenance and are extremely durable. If left unmaintained, over time, they could have issues such as defective hinges or handles misting of double-glazed and an inefficiency of energy.

Many of these problems can be solved with little effort, saving you money on the cost of replacement windows.

Water Leaks

A window that leaks could cause costly damage to ceilings and upvc window repairs walls. It is crucial to act swiftly if you notice water leaking from your windows. Leaks in uPVC windows is usually due to the weather seals failing, and is easily fixed. If you suspect that this is the issue, it's best to buy some new caulking. Apply a new coat. This is a low-cost, easy-to-do home repair that could save you a significant amount of money in the end.

Another common indication of a window that has a leak is the appearance of condensation inside the glass. It may not be as severe as a water leak however it's a sign that the window is no longer an effective barrier to insulate. This could be a major issue during colder seasons.

You should examine your windows both in and out of your home. Examine for signs of water damage or stains and examine the sill to ensure it is sloping enough to allow rainwater to be able to drain away from the window. Examine the flashing for damage. This is the material installed on the frame to block moisture from entering the walls and ceiling.

Faulty Hinges

Window hinges are a mechanical component that needs regular maintenance. They can become worn down and damaged, which can cause the window to be difficult to open or close. If you're experiencing issues with your windows, it's vital to get the hinges repaired as soon as possible to keep your home safe from weather and unauthorised access.

The hinges on your uPVC windows could be worn out. This is a common issue that can be fixed with a few easy steps. You will first have to take the hinges from the frame. Then, you'll need to replace the hinges with new ones. Be sure to use the proper screws and install them correctly when replacing hinges. Make sure to check the size of the screws because uPVC frames are different from timber frames.

Stuck Handles

A issue with the handle mechanism is most likely to blame for stuck uPVC. The mechanisms can be fixed in a relatively quick time, ensuring the windows function properly. To avoid any problems it is essential to regularly clean and maintain uPVC Windows.

The most popular types of uPVC window handle are espagnolette handles. They operate multipoint locking systems which enhances the security of the window, with cams that look like mushrooms that are locked into the frame that the window keeps. The handle is usually capable of opening or closing the window with no problems. However, if the handle becomes stuck, it could be due to a problem with the spindle inside the handle.

Luckily, replacing a uPVC window handle is quite a simple process that can be completed by anyone with basic tools and skills. To replace a handle effectively you need to identify the handle type and measure the spindle. Then, purchase an alternative handle that is exactly the same size as the original one. Once you have the proper tools and the replacement part will not take more than 30 mins.
